District in Phnom Penh, Cambodia
Chamkar Mon (Khmer: ចំការមន, meaning 'Mulberry Farm') is the southernmost district in central Phnom Penh, Cambodia. The district has an area of 10.56km. As of the 2019 census, its population was 70,772.
Administration
Chamkar Mon was subdivided into 12 Sangkats and 95 Phums (villages).
On January 8, 2019, according to sub-decree 03 អនក្រ.បក, 7 sangkats from Khan Chamkar Mon have been moved to a new khan, Khan Boeng Keng Kang.
Education
The Canadian International School of Phnom Penh maintains its main campus on Koh Pich in Chamkar Mon Section and the Bassac Garden Preschool in the Chamkar Mon Section.
iCan British International School is in Tonle Bassac commune.
DK SchoolHouse is in the embassy district of Phnom Penh.
